ENThe most ancient cultic monuments of Vileyka district have been studied since the middle of the XIX century. Many well-known scientists, such as A. Kirkor, K. Tyshkevich, E. Romanov, A. Sapunov, A. Pokrovsky, visited this district. The cultic boulders, springs, streams, lakes, bogs and mountains can be observed on the territory of the region. The most significant group of cultic boulders - boulders with holes - was found in the valleys of the rivers Naroch, Viliya and Iliya near the sites of the Stone and Bronze Ages. The other groups of cultic stones were found in the area between the two rivers: Naroch and Viliya, near the site of the ancient settlement of the Iron Age. The major group of the cultic boulders here - the petrified bullocks and oxen. The motif of the church, tavern and wedding that collapsed under the ground is spread in Vileyka district. The topic of the "cursed river" can be observed near the sites of the ancient settlements of the Iron Age. Local population thinks that the water in the holy springs cures eyesight.
